We have seen that players are sometimes losing significant amounts of MMR after a match has ended, with no indication that it was a roll back from a cheater being banned.

Our team is currently investigating. As a precaution, we have deactivated the MMR Roll Back feature while we determine the root cause. For those of you curious about the intended functionality of the MMR Roll Back feature, you can learn more here.

We will update you further when we have more information.

UPDATE 1

We have found that the pop up to notify players their MMR is being rolled back is not triggering, and thus not being displayed when a roll back has occurred.

Additionally, matches that needed to be rolled back were not flagged as "complete" once the MMR was removed from players in that match. This lead to roll backs occurring multiple times for the same match, creating larger than intended losses.

UPDATE 2

We have confirmed that we have a record of all MMR lost due to this issue, and will be able to restore MMR to those impacted. We put together a script to do that today, but it came with additional risks that we were not comfortable with taking.

As such, we will discuss and work on a solution when our entire team is back in the office on Monday. An additional update will come on Monday when we have a more clear idea of our next steps!

UPDATE 3

We have restored MMR that was lost to all impacted players. We have also restored the uncertainty value to what it was prior to the massive MMR losses, so players will be able move through the ranks as originally intended.
